Does anyone know what supplement you take to help thicken your hair to help with the Hair loss? I haven't had surgery yet but my nurse practitioner recommended I start taking something now but I can't remember what it is!!

It's Biotin. But it is not a sure remedy. If your body decides it needs to place Hair growth on hold, my understanding is, it will. But Biotin is supposed to help. I have been advised to wait until 4 weeks to start because I should not take anything that is not absolutely necessary until my pouch is completely healed. Makes sense!

I started Biotin immediately (three days after surgery), and because of my inability to drink Protein Shakes I was instructed to increase the mcg's to 10,000 per day instead of the normally recommended 5,000. I have it in both the dissolving and pill form, and haven't had a problem taking either. I'm only seven weeks out so haven't begun to lose my hair yet. I take several Vitamins a day in both pill form and Gummy form and have had no problems ingesting any of them.
